Inventory/warehouse Supervisor Position

4 weeks ago


North Vancouver, Canada Johnstone's Barbecues and Parts Full time

Ensure seasonal staff is following your lead by example doing the following tasks daily:
**Warehouse tasks**
- Read work orders to assemble Barbecues by hand or by using small hand operated equipment
- Build barbecues and other appliances for delivery, test fire and wrap for storage until delivery
- Identify units that fail tests or tolerance levels and repair as necessary
- Maintain neat and orderly work areas and comply with all safety rules
- Provide first class customer service when interacting with public
- As needed be the second delivery team member on Barbecue deliveries to customers home’s
- Other duties as assigned

**Inventory tasks**
- Maintain a clean and organized warehouse
- Ship items as required, including contacting freight companies and completing appropriate forms
- Receive shipments and ensure integrity of the inventory on shipments
- Reporting and shipment discrepancies to purchasing department
- Assist retail staff in carrying and loading heavy product for customers
- Organize, restock and maintain inventory, transfer from locations as needed
- Create labels and barcodes for inventory arriving on shipment
- Setting up displays on retail floor
- Keeping a clean and presentable showroom

**Showroom tasks**
- ring through basic purchases
- greet customers as you see them
- assist sales team as needed

**Maintenance tasks**
- Keep washrooms, staffroom and parking lot clean and tidy
- Ensure garbage’s and cardboard are taken out daily
- Ensure all printed invoice copies are shredded
- Snow removal in winter
- keeping storefront glass windows clean
- Keeping floors and products in showroom dust free and neat
- Emptying paper shredders frequently

**Supervisory work**:

- Mandatory weekends
- Interviewing and hiring builders and delivery team for the Barbecue season
- Creating a fluid team with Seasonal staff
- Training the seasonal team on Johnstone’s policy and work ethics
- Ensure at all times that company standards are met
- Oversee all aspects of warehouse operations, including receiving, storing, organizing, and distribution
- Develop and implement warehouse policies and procedures to ensure effective and efficient operations
- Ensure accurate inventory management through regular cycle counts and location transfers
- Track tools and ensure that tools are not lost or broken
- Assist delivery crews to efficiently load vehicles with appropriate tools each morning and assist in

unloading end of day
- Notify Management when inventory ordering is needed
- Assist in process improvements
- Resolve problems that arise, such as customer complaints and supply shortages
- Prepare reports on sales volumes, merchandising and personnel matters
- Attend meetings as required
